Outperforming while anticipating a market recovery
The Mercantile Investment Trust aims to provide capital growth as well as a growing dividend by investing in a diversified portfolio of UK mid- and small-cap stocks. It is the largest investment trust invested predominantly in the UK market, with assets of £2.1bn. The investment philosophy is focused on quality growth opportunities. Guy Anderson has been the fund’s lead manager since 2015, having previously been co-manager. Anthony Lynch is the co-manager of the portfolio and has worked on the fund since 2009. The fund has outperformed over the last five years, with a NAV total return of 38% compared with 25% for the FTSE All Share Index (ex FTSE 100 ex IT). Its returns compare favourably to peers as well, outperforming its closest comparators JPMorgan Mid Cap and Schroder UK Mid Cap over the past five years, three years and the last twelve months, with a similar dividend yield.
